Munck is able to offer equipment and systems
for rehabilitation of cranes, which may double the life time
of existing cranes.
The rehabilitation project of a crane may involve installation
of a complete new hoisting machinery, drive system or other
additional equipment representing a considerable better and
improved design compared to the existing equipment. This is
among other resulting in that the noise level is reduced, improved
and safer braking systems are achieved, improved starting and
stopping characteristics and generally higher degree of safety
is obtained. In addition, and under certain circumstances, the
entire crane can be upgraded to a higher lifting capacity. Our

Remote control.
Remote control will improve safety as operator will obtain better
control of crane and load. Several systems and designs are available.
Stepless control.
Stepless control offers accurate positioning of load, it reduces
brake wear and wear in general, and prevents "inching" of load.
This means increased safety and reduced maintenance costs.
Electronic weighing system with built into overload switch.
Display giving information of load being lifted at any time.
Automatic registering of accumulatec loads lifted. Monitoring
and registering of the degree of use of the crane (time and
load) as well as the "life time" of the crane (safe working
period = SWP), expressed in fuil-load hours.

Safety equipment.
Limit switches for the long and cross travel motion, anti-collision
systems between cranes operating on the same runway, but also
between hanging load on one crane and crane operating on a lower
runway level. Further, the cranes can be equipped with equipment
which automatically restricting operation of cranes - or load
on the hook - to certain areas or zones inside the building. Munck
cranes can also be fitted with equipment preventing over-winding
wire rope as well as a rope wear registering device. Safety is
